OK, the scam.

Poster has a travel business or is involved in some sort of marketing scheme. They come on and say they are a "writer" looking for stories and ask you to email or call them. They then try and talk you into one of their tours/schemes/etc. Or, they take your stories and simply use them for their business as advertising.

I remember Pauline talking about people being paid to try and push a travel business by coming on as a new member and right off the bat raving about said business or suggest an article with a link that then takes you to the business. You can spot them a mile away!
